Shopify’s VAT MOSS Function

A huge plus of using Shopify that rarely gets mentioned in Shopify reviews is its VAT MOSS, or VAT Mini One Stop Shop, functionality, which is extremely important if you frequently sell digital products to customers in the EU.

VAT MOSS is an EU requirement in which digital products must have the value added tax, or VAT, added to every digital product for each individual EU country. For instance, A VAT rate must be applied to every digital product sold in the UK, and another one must be added for France, and then Italy, and so on.

Unlike many of Shopify’s competitors, Shopify automatically calculates the appropriate VAT rate. This means there’s no need to do this manually, which can be a real hassle. For many, this alone is a powerful unique selling proposition for Shopify over its competitors.

Digital Products and Shopify
Speaking of digital products, while most people use Shopify to sell physical goods, it can be used to sell digital products as well. In order to do so, however, you need to visit Shopify’s app store and install the ‘Digital Downloads App.’

While this is an extra step, the app is free and extremely easy to use. It can also be configured to work automatically. After ordering with a credit card through Shopify Payments or a payment gateway, the download link is automatically emailed to the customer to fulfill their order.

That said, there is a limit on how large the product files can be. With Shopify, only products 5GB and under can be sold. Once again, there are ways to work around this through the use of third-party apps, but with this comes added costs.
